World Donald Sheppard, British D-Day Veteran, Dies at 104 September 11, 2024Amelia NierenbergComments Off on Donald Sheppard, British D-Day Veteran, Dies at 104 He helped liberate Bergen-Belsen, the Nazi concentration camp where Anne Frank had died.